Overview Cilcontrol 10 Tablet
Tenmg Cilcontrol tablets manage hypertension, a condition characterized by elevated blood pressure. Classified as a calcium channel blocker, this medication lowers blood pressure, thus reducing the risk of stroke and heart attack. It's also prescribed to prevent angina. Dosage varies based on individual needs and may be used alone or in conjunction with other treatments. Timing of intake is flexible—with or without food—but consistency is key. Continue treatment as directed by your physician; abrupt cessation, even with symptom improvement, can worsen hypertension, often asymptomatic. Lifestyle changes, including exercise, weight management, and healthy eating, further enhance blood pressure control. Common side effects include tiredness, swelling in the lower extremities, drowsiness, dizziness, facial flushing, irregular heartbeat, and headache. Report persistent or bothersome side effects to your doctor; note that swelling and palpitations are often milder than with comparable drugs. Research suggests renal protective benefits. Prior to commencing treatment, disclose any existing liver, kidney, or heart conditions; pregnant or lactating individuals require medical consultation. Comprehensive disclosure of all other medications, especially cardiovascular treatments, is essential. Regular blood pressure monitoring ensures treatment efficacy.

How to use Cilcontrol 10 Tablet:
Administer this medication precisely as your physician directs, adhering to both the prescribed dosage and treatment length. Ingest the tablet whole; avoid chewing, crushing, or fracturing it. Cilcontrol 10 Tablets can be consumed with or without food, although consistent timing is recommended.
How Cilcontrol 10 Tablet works:
Ten-milligram Cilcontrol tablets function as calcium channel blockers, reducing blood pressure via vasodilation and thereby improving the heart's pumping efficiency.

What if you forget to take Cilcontrol 10 Tablet :
Should you forget to take a Cilcontrol 10 Tablet,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ing pattern. Avoid taking a double dose.
